Bill Moore, baseball player, 1986-1986

Bill Moore

Born: 10/10/1960 in Los Angeles, CA, USA

MLB Debut: 1986-07-19 | Final Game: 1986-07-25

Bats: R | Throws: L | Height: 6'1" | Weight: 185 lbs

Full name: William Ross Moore

Biography

Bill Moore was a professional baseball player born in 1960, who had a brief career in Major League Baseball during the summer of 1986. His time in the majors was notably short, as he played only six games for the team, making his debut on July 19, 1986, and concluding his stint just a week later on July 25, 1986. Despite the limited opportunity, Moore contributed to his team as a position player, showcasing the challenges and unpredictability faced by many athletes trying to make their mark in the competitive landscape of professional baseball. During his six-game tenure, Moore recorded two hits, resulting in a batting average of .167. He did not hit any home runs or drive in runs, nor did he steal any bases.
